The combination of , Settle3D v2.0 , Slide 6.0 , and Unwedge 3.0 forms a comprehensive geotechnical toolset. It covers the full spectrum of analysis, from analyzing raw geological data (Dips) to determining the stability of slopes (Slide), calculating foundation settlements (Settle3D), and designing underground supports (Unwedge).
